Visa-Free Destinations For U.S. Travelers
Are you wondering where US citizens can travel without a visa? You are at the correct place. Here are some of the visa-free travel destinations from the U.S. to explore and enjoy.
1. Japan
Maximum Stay: 90 days
Why Visit: Japan is a seamless blend of ancient tradition and ultra-modern life. U.S. passport holders can explore Kyoto’s temples, indulge in Tokyo’s cuisine, and witness cherry blossoms, all without a visa. With efficient transport and welcoming locals, it’s a top travel choice for 2026-2027.
Best Airlines: Japan Airlines, ANA, or United Airlines (nonstop from major US cities).
Tip: Plan your visit during cherry blossom season in spring for picture-perfect views.
2. Mexico
Maximum Stay: 180 days
Why Visit: Mexico remains one of the most accessible long-stay visa-free options for U.S. citizens. With rich history, delicious cuisine, and diverse landscapes, from Mayan ruins and Mexico City to Cancun’s beaches; it offers a versatile escape.
Best Airlines: Aeromexico, Delta, American Airlines
Tip: Check out less-touristy spots like Oaxaca or San Cristóbal.

4. Uzbekistan (New for 2026)
Maximum Stay: 30 days
Why Visit: From 1 January 2026, U.S. citizens will be granted visa-free entry into Uzbekistan for up to 30 days, according to official updates. This opens up Central Asia’s Silk-Road landscapes, ancient cities like Samarkand, and rich cultural heritage for U.S. travelers.
Best Airlines: Uzbekistan Airways (via Tashkent)
Tip: Book early for peak seasons; English-speaking guides are still limited outside major cities.
Visa on Arrival Destinations
1. Egypt
Maximum Stay: 30 days (tourist visa on arrival)
Why Visit: U.S. travelers can obtain a visa on arrival in Egypt for tourism, no prior application to an embassy required. Explore the Pyramids of Giza, cruise the Nile, relax on Red Sea resorts with minimal entry hassle.
Best Airlines: EgyptAir, Delta
Tip: Have some cash ready for visa fee at arrival; carry a hotel booking.
2. Jordan
Maximum Stay: 30 days (Visa on arrival or Jordan Pass option)
Why Visit: Jordan welcomes U.S. passport holders with visa-on-arrival for tourism; it also offers the Jordan Pass which includes entry to many sites. Ideal for exploring Petra, Wadi Rum and Dead Sea without a lengthy visa process.
Best Airlines: Royal Jordanian, Delta
Tip: Consider getting the Jordan Pass online before arrival. It might reduce cost and streamline entry.
e-Visa / ETA Destinations
1. Singapore
Maximum Stay: 90 days
Why Visit: Though traditionally visa-free for U.S. citizens, for many travellers a pre-travel Electronic Travel Authorisation (ETA) may be required or recommended. Singapore offers world-class infrastructure, diverse cuisine, and a very safe travel environment.
Best Airlines: Singapore Airlines, United
Tip: Make sure your passport has at least 6 months validity remaining and you have onward travel planned.
2. Cambodia
Maximum Stay: 30 days (e-Visa or Visa on Arrival)
Why Visit: For U.S. citizens heading to Southeast Asia, Cambodia offers convenient entry via e-Visa or visa on arrival — making it an attractive choice for first-time travellers in the region. Explore Angkor Wat, floating villages and friendly local communities.
Best Airlines: Cambodia Angkor Air (via Siem Reap), major carriers via Bangkok or Singapore
Tip: Apply for the e-Visa online ahead of travel to skip possible queues at arrival airports.

FAQs
1. Do American citizens need a visa for Europe in 2026?
Starting October 12, 2025, U.S. citizens must use the EU's new Entry and Exit System when traveling to 29 European countries. This applies to trips of up to 90 days within a 180-day period, but it’s not a traditional visa.

3. Can I stay in visa-free countries as a U.S. citizen for a long time?
Most countries offer visa-free access for short stays, usually ranging from 30 to 90 days. Longer stays may require additional documentation.
